Corrosion of aluminum alloy 2024 caused by Aspergillus

2016111 · In this study, we observed and characterized the corrosion of one aluminum-copper alloy, AA 2024-T3, corroded by a common fungal species A. niger in a humid and sterile atmospheric environment. We placed AA 2024-T3 coupons on potato dextrose agar (PDA) surfaces, and then dispersed an A. niger spore suspension onto the

Effect of the fungus, Aspergillus niger, on the corrosion

201591 · Effect of Aspergillus niger (A. niger) on the corrosion behaviour of AZ31B magnesium alloy in artificial seawater (AS) has been studied.The presence of A. niger posed a threat for AZ31B magnesium alloy. A visible decrease in pH and E corr vs. SCE was observed in AS with A. niger compared to the sterile AS, and the presence of A. niger

What is Uranus 52N+? - Langley Alloys

Ferralium 255 (UNS32550, DIN 1.4507, F61) is the original SDSS, developed by Langley Alloys in the 1960’s. It is still the only super duplex to provide a yield strength greater than 85ksi. At the same time, the increased copper content (2%) of Ferralium 255 ensures greater resistance to acids in comparison to other alloys of that type.

Types of Nickel Alloys and their Properties - Thomasnet

 · Nickel-Chromium Alloys. Nickel-chromium alloys are prized for their high corrosion resistance, high-temperature strength, and high electrical resistance. For example, the alloy NiCr 70/30, also designated as Ni70Cr30, Nikrothal 70, Resistohm 70, and X30H70 has a melting point of 1380 o C and an electrical resistivity of 1.18 μΩ-m.
